sysnchronized的实现原理与应用

在并发编程中,synchronized一直是被使用很是频繁的,不少人会把它称为重量级锁,可是,JavaSE1.6对它有一个重大优化,在1.6中为了减小得到锁和释放锁带来的性能消耗而引入了偏向锁和轻量级锁。编程 咱们知道Java中的每个对象均可以做为锁,具体表现为三种形式:数组 1.对于普通同步方法,锁是当前实例对象安全 2.对于静态同步方法,锁是当前类的Class对象多线程 3.对于同步代码块,锁
相关文章
相关标签/搜索